A restaurant, a bar/lounge, and a coffee shop/cafe are available at this smoke-free hotel. Free WiFi in public areas and free self parking are also provided. Additionally, a 24-hour front desk and a garden are onsite.
The Bridge Hotel offers 51 accommodations with coffee/tea makers and hair dryers. Flat-screen televisions come with premium cable channels.
Bathrooms include shower/tub combinations and complimentary toiletries. This Chertsey hotel provides complimentary wireless Internet access. Housekeeping is provided daily.
The hotel offers a restaurant and a coffee shop/cafe. A bar/lounge is on site where guests can unwind with a drink. Wireless Internet access is complimentary. This Chertsey hotel also offers a terrace, a garden, and an elevator. Complimentary self parking is available on site.
The Bridge Hotel is a smoke-free property.
English breakfasts are available for a surcharge on weekdays between 7 AM and 10 AM and on weekends between 8 AM and 10 AM.
The Boat House - This restaurant specializes in Modern European cuisine and serves breakfast, lunch, and dinner. A children's menu is available.

It isn’t a large hotel which makes it much more personable. Beautiful spacious rooms, especially the ones over looking the river with Juliet balcony, where you can watch the ducks & swans- all very idyllic. Staff are helpful & always available.
Downstairs gives plenty of traditional country style pub vibes. If you are looking for an upmarket place to relax & chill out, this is the place to be. A major plus is the free on site parking. There is a 2 tier parking area next to hotel.
Only issue was when they were very busy ( non residents use it in the evening, enjoying the terrace & conservatory overlooking the river) then the younger staff members struggled to manage orders.
Would definitely return as the atmosphere, quality of service & food far out weighed any slight disadvantages. Good for transport links around London & lovely local countryside.
